Ali Al Hadi Elchab
Canadian citizen · Beirut, Lebanon · Remote with EST overlap

Ali Al Hadi Elchab
Flutter Mobile Engineer

I build production Flutter apps for business systems — from mobile architecture to APIs, CI/CD, and store releases.

3+ years FlutterCanadian citizen · EST overlap
View CV

About Me

Product-focused Flutter developer shipping production mobile apps end to end across ecommerce, warehouse management, CRM, and e-book platforms. Strong in clean architecture, Cubit/Bloc, GoRouter, Firebase, Laravel backends, and App Store / Play Store release workflows. Canadian citizen based in Beirut, Lebanon, available for remote roles with EST overlap.

  • Mobile: Flutter, Dart, Cubit/Bloc, GoRouter, Clean Architecture, Firebase, REST Integration, Push Notifications (FCM)
  • Backend: Laravel, MySQL, REST APIs, JWT/OAuth, DB Design, Multi-role Auth Systems
  • Tools: App Store Connect, Google Play Console, Git, Postman, Docker, Linux, Firebase Console
  • Languages: PHP, Dart, JavaScript
  • Spoken: English (fluent), Arabic (native)

My Projects

CiviSol — Warehouse Management System preview
Client Project
CiviSol — Warehouse Management System

Warehouse management system for inventory control and stock operations. Handles multi-warehouse flows, barcode scanning, live stock syncing, purchases, and sales across multiple user roles — connected to a Laravel REST backend.

Excellence Quality — CRM Platform preview
Client Project
Excellence Quality — CRM Platform

CRM and lead management platform with client portal, activity tracking, service management, and multi-role access. Built end to end in Flutter with a Laravel backend.

FreshZone — eCommerce App preview
Client Project
FreshZone — eCommerce App

eCommerce mobile app for a supermarket chain. Full shopping experience — category browsing, product search, cart, promo handling, and checkout flow. Built with clean architecture and a Laravel backend.

Dar Alrafidain — E-book Platform preview
Dar Alrafidain — E-book Platform

Arabic e-book platform live on App Store and Play Store. Features in-app purchases, online payments, offline reading with encrypted downloads, posts and announcements, and a rich digital library with a smooth reading experience.

Sweet Deals — eCommerce App preview
Sweet Deals — eCommerce App

eCommerce mobile app for a sweets and chocolates shop in Lebanon. Supports bulk buying, product browsing across categories including chocolates, candies, and drinks, with a smooth checkout experience.

Servio — Service Provider Marketplace preview
Servio — Service Provider Marketplace

Multi-role marketplace connecting service providers with customers. Providers subscribe monthly to list their services across categorized directories. Features provider profiles, media uploads, deep linking, and category-based discovery — built in Flutter with a Laravel backend.

Flutter Starter Skeleton preview
Flutter Starter Skeleton

A production-ready Flutter starter kit designed for scalable apps. Includes clean architecture, Cubit state management, GoRouter navigation, reusable auth flow, API handler, theming, localization, and environment config. Cut new project setup time by 60%.

QuickPOS — POS Desktop App preview
QuickPOS — POS Desktop App

QuickPOS is a focused POS desktop proof of concept built with Flutter Desktop and a C#/.NET backend API.

Get in touch

Flutter Developer open to remote roles and freelance projects. Building production mobile apps with clean architecture and Laravel backends. Reach out through any of the links below.

+961 71 461 762

alielchab01@gmail.com

Github Icon

github.com/Ali-Elchab

Github Icon

linkedin.com/in/ali-elchab/